Description
  • Uncle Lee's naturally grown Bai Mu Dan White Tea (also known as "White Peony") is grown in the mountains of the Fujian Province of China and is from the most tender young buds and leaves that remain after the legendary Silver Needle has been harvested. White tea (youngest camellia sinensis) undergoes very little processing (steaming, rolling and oxidation) which leaves the appearance and cell structure of the leaves nearly unaltered. This purity may be what some researchers have found that causes white teas to have a greater concentration of cancer fighting antioxidants than all other teas. White teas have all of the benefits of green tea and are the most delicate of all, their taste being subtle, complex and mildly sweet. Because there is very little processing with white tea, the caffeine content is also fairly low at approximately 15 to 20 mg per cup. In comparison, green tea contains 20 to 40 mg per cup, black tea contains 50 to 55 mg per 8 oz. cup and common coffee contains about 100 to 120 mg per cup on the average. Instructions

  • Hot Serving: Place one tea bag into an 8 oz empty cup. Pour 75C to 85C degree of hot water over tea bag and steep for 2 to 5 minutes depending on desired strength.
  • Iced Serving: For one quart of iced tea, pour 2 cups of boiling water over 4 tea bags. Brew 4 to 6 minutes. Then add 2 cups of cold water and chill to desired temperature for serving.
